Q1: What factors affect the UK DIY rate?
A: Material quality, shed design complexity, and regional price variations can affect the cost per square meter.
Q2: Does this include labor costs?
A: No, this calculator only estimates material costs for DIY projects where you provide the labor.
Q3: What's a typical UK DIY rate range?
A: Rates typically range from £50-£150 per square meter depending on materials and shed quality.
Q4: Should I include foundation costs?
A: Foundation costs are separate and should be calculated additionally to the main shed material costs.
Q5: Can I use this for different shed types?
A: Yes, but adjust the rate according to the specific materials needed for different shed types (wood, metal, plastic).
